Hair: Yeah, Yeah!

I've lately formed a habit of plaiting my hair after I wash it. I wait until it's almost completely dry and form a plait starting as high up my head as possible. This is how my hair looks when I take it out the next day:





I just run my fingers through and voila! The waves do loosen up a bit during the day but since I started using Tigi Catwalk Styling Cream (before plaiting) they hold their shape a lot better. A spritz of hairspray means that it still looks wavy the next day :) I'm on the lookout for some good sea salt spray to see if it makes any difference. My hair is pretty straight- slightly wavy but mostly straight. Not bad for just a plait, eh?
